I&C Engineering Technician

Job Description

The Engineering Technician supports prototype builds and instrumentation and controls (I&C) systems by assembling, wiring, testing, and reworking electronic components and systems in a dynamic lab environment. This role involves hands-on work such as soldering, cable and harness fabrication, panel wiring, and system-level testing using tools like multimeters and oscilloscopes to verify performance. You will collaborate closely with engineers, maintain thorough documentation, and help ensure the lab operates with high standards of organization, quality, and safety. This position suits someone who enjoys precision craftsmanship, is comfortable with shifting priorities, and is eager to deepen their experience in instrumentation, controls, and system testing.

Responsibilities

  • Assemble and build instrumentation and controls (I&C) system components, panels, and assemblies in accordance with engineering drawings, wiring diagrams, and work instructions.
  • Perform bench-level testing of sensors, transmitters, controllers, and signal conditioning equipment to verify proper operation.
  • Support system integration by wiring, configuring, and verifying I&C connections and test setups.
  • Assist with prototype builds, including hardware troubleshooting, rework, and calibration activities.
  • Perform rework on prototype cards, including soldering, rewiring, and component-level modifications such as adding resistors or rerouting connections.
  • Execute calibration and verification procedures using standard lab equipment to ensure accurate and reliable measurements.
  • Use test equipment such as multimeters, oscilloscopes, power supplies, and signal generators to verify system performance and diagnose issues.
  • Fabricate cables and harnesses, including crimping, labeling, connector installation, and ensuring proper routing, strain relief, and grounding.
  • Carry out panel wiring and general wiring tasks for chassis, cabinets, and complete system builds.
  • Support functional and environmental testing such as continuity checks, insulation resistance measurements, and signal verification.
  • Prepare instrumentation and test setups for system-level or field testing, ensuring all connections and configurations meet requirements.
  • Document build and test results, including assembly records, test data, and nonconformance reports, in a clear and organized manner.
  • Maintain lab organization, tool control, and a clean, orderly, and safe working environment.
  • Follow all Environmental, Health, and Safety (EHS) standards, lab protocols, and ESD handling procedures.
  • Collaborate with engineers and other technicians to identify, troubleshoot, and resolve design or test issues discovered during lab work.
  • Contribute to continuous improvement by providing feedback and updating procedures, work instructions, and documentation as needed.
  • Adapt to shifting priorities on a day-to-day and hour-to-hour basis, supporting multiple projects and prototype efforts as needs change.
  • Participate in full shakeout of chassis, cabinet, and system builds, ensuring systems are thoroughly tested and ready for further development or deployment.

Work Environment

This role is fully onsite in an electronics lab environment. You will work primarily with electronic assemblies, instrumentation, and control systems, using tools such as soldering equipment, crimp tools, multimeters, oscilloscopes, power supplies, and other standard lab instruments. The typical schedule follows an 8-hour day starting around 7:00 a.m., with some flexibility when needed, though not to an extreme degree. Occasional travel may be possible but is expected to be limited. The work is hands-on, fast-paced, and involves supporting multiple projects and prototype builds, often requiring quick adaptation to changing priorities and tasks. The lab emphasizes organization, tool control, and adherence to Environmental, Health, and Safety (EHS) standards, including proper ESD handling procedures. Attire is suitable for a lab and light manufacturing environment, supporting safe and comfortable performance of hands-on technical work.
